Output 149600f99bc332f6b94ae057879616bf8cff1bea523281024bfddce759863692:1

value
4435379864
script pubkey
OP_0 OP_PUSHBYTES_20 ef0b822bb2a74c6dc4e04c033e622323b53921b0
address
tb1qau9cy2aj5axxm38qfspnuc3ryw6njgdsvqygna
transaction
149600f99bc332f6b94ae057879616bf8cff1bea523281024bfddce759863692